Künker sale 386, lot 5063

This specimen was lot 5063 in Künker sale 386 (Osnabrück, March 2023), where it sold for €1,800 (about US$2,326 including buyer's fees). The catalog description[1] noted,

"BRAUNSCHWEIG-WOLFENBÜTTEL, FÜRSTENTUM, Ferdinand Albrecht II. 1735. Reichstaler 1735, Zellerfeld. Von großer Seltenheit. Herrliche Patina, min. Prägeschwäche, sehr schön-vorzüglich. Exemplar der Slg. Elbeshausen, Auktion Westfälische Auktionsgesellschaft 68, Dortmund 2014, Nr. 477. (duchy of Brunswick-Wolfenbuttel, Ferdinand Albrecht II, 1735, thaler of 1735, Zellerfeld mint. Extremely rare, superb patina, slightly weakly struck, very fine to extremely fine.)"

Ferdinand Albrecht's brief reign allowed little time for the production of coins and his thalers (Dav-2142, Dav-2143, Dav-2144) are all rare, some extremely so.

Recorded mintage: unknown.

Specification: silver, this specimen 29.00 g.

Catalog reference: KM 880, Dav-2142; Welter 2674.
